Rada strengthens measures to ensure security of judges and their families
Ukrainian MPs on Thursday supported a bill to strengthen measures ensuring the security of judges and their families.
The law, which was supported by 235 deputies, envisages amendments to the legislation on the judicial system, which strengthen security measures with respect to judges, their families, as well as the employees of courts and law enforcement agencies.
Moreover, the law simplifies the procedure for prosecuting people for contempt of court. It also proposes strengthening penalties for actions related to the disruption of the normal functioning of transport, the violation of rules for holding meetings, and non-compliance with the requirements of the competent authorities.
The law foresees such amendments to the Criminal Code as increased penalties for crimes related to the disruption of public order and intervention in the work of judicial and law enforcement agencies.
